Best Vitamins For Men Fertility

There are many vitamins and minerals that are important for male fertility. Some of the most important vitamins for male fertility include vitamin C, vitamin E, zinc, and selenium.

Vitamin C is important for male fertility because it helps to protect the sperm from oxidative damage. It also helps to improve the sperm’s ability to move through the female reproductive system.

Vitamin E is important for male fertility because it helps to protect the sperm from oxidative damage and it helps to improve the sperm’s ability to move through the female reproductive system.

Zinc is important for male fertility because it helps to protect the sperm from oxidative damage and it helps to improve the sperm’s ability to move through the female reproductive system.

Selenium is important for male fertility because it helps to protect the sperm from oxidative damage.

Fertility Help Without Insurance

: A Review of Options

The high cost of fertility treatments can be a barrier to couples seeking help to conceive. For those who have insurance, fertility treatments may be partially or fully covered, but for those who don’t have insurance, the cost of treatment can be prohibitive. Fertility treatments such as in vitro fertilization (IVF) can cost up to $12,000 per cycle.

There are a number of options available for those who want to conceive but do not have insurance coverage for fertility treatments. Some of these options include using donor sperm, using donor eggs, using a fertility loan, or using a fertility savings account.

Donor sperm can be used in conjunction with intrauterine insemination (IUI) or IVF. The cost of donor sperm varies depending on the sperm bank, but is typically around $300-500 per vial.

Donor eggs can be used in conjunction with IUI or IVF. The cost of donor eggs varies depending on the egg bank, but is typically around $5,000-7,000 per cycle.

There are a number of fertility loans available, which typically have interest rates of 10-12%. The amount of the loan varies, but is typically around $5,000-10,000.

Does Birth Control Decrease Fertility



?

There is a lot of misinformation out there about birth control and its effects on fertility. Some people believe that birth control will cause infertility, while others believe that it is a form of contraception that is 100% effective. The truth is that birth control can have both positive and negative effects on fertility, depending on the type of birth control that is used.

In general, birth control pills and other hormonal contraceptives can reduce fertility. This is because they work by suppressing ovulation, which can decrease the number of eggs that are available for fertilization. However, some women may still be able to get pregnant while taking hormonal contraceptives, and they are not 100% effective at preventing pregnancy.

Barrier methods of contraception, such as condoms and diaphragms, do not usually have a negative effect on fertility. However, they are not 100% effective at preventing pregnancy, either.

Ultimately, the effect that birth control has on fertility depends on the individual woman. Some women may experience a decrease in fertility while others may not. If you are concerned about the effect that birth control may have on your fertility, talk to your doctor. They can help you choose the type of birth control that is best for you.
